Site Intelligence & Field Accuracy
Startech has completed thousands of site visits across North America. During business site surveys, engineers validate:
- Customer address, access paths, power, grounding, and backboards
- Existing fiber facilities and switching infrastructure
- Entrance facility (EF) eligibility and SPF requirements
- Fiber path feasibility and equipment placement
Marked photos, checklists, and layouts are captured and uploaded to engineering systems for seamless design workflows.
Records Research & Route Validation
Using standard carrier records, Startech engineers identify fiber pickup points, mark work areas, map facilities, and assist field teams. Field visits then confirm the closest access point, define the least-resistance route, and capture aerial or buried construction needs. Any scope deviations are immediately coordinated with customers and engineering teams.
Planning, Design & Compliance
During High-Level Design (HLD), Startech validates addresses, easements, routes, splice locations, terminals, handholes, and fiber counts. Designs are posted into GIS systems and drafted per State guidelines, including live clips, caution notes, and facility addresses.
Material Ordering & Quality Control
Through integrated tasking tools, Startech aligns design with:
- Cable, duct, handhole, and pole orders
- Labor and splicing tasks
- Boring, digging, and special construction steps
Each project is quality-checked against field notes, posting standards, regional rules, and task accuracy to eliminate errors before construction.
